The Software Test Engineer has responsibilities extending to the design and development of test system software and hardware within the operations environments of the Global Supply chain. The position may develop distributed software applications for real-time automated test system solutions. This role will join Edwards Critical Care division that is innovating at a rapid pace and seeking a seasoned veteran to support the Operations Team.
Essential job functions include:
Lead test system development on National Instruments based standard test platform for new product introductions, including concept, architecture, documentation, design, prototype, test, supplier interfaces, manufacturing introduction and service.
Act as the technical SME to debug and enhance test software and firmware on production testers and service testers.
Responsible to identify hardware in test system and design product interface fixture needed to fulfil product test requirements.
Ensure regulatory compliance through Qualification & Validation. Responsible for ensuring rigor in determining processes requiring validation, development of plans and analysis criteria, execution and final analysis and acceptance
Expertise in development software for interaction with microcontrollers, test equipment, and databases.
Expertise in writing modular software that can be re-used across different testers.
Responsible for software development lifecycle, leveraging Agile and Lean software development methodologies to drive reliability upstream into the development life cycle
Experience in PCBA and electronic system testing with the ability to read and understand PCBA schematics and layouts.
Experience in documentation, writing specifications, change control process, and tester and software validation
Experience with a host of communication protocols; I2C, SPI, RS232/RS422/RS485, USB, UART
Able to analyze the trade-offs between performance, manufacturability, and cost

Qualifications:
Min 7 years over all experience.
Bachelor s Degree in Computer Science or in STEM Majors (Science, Technology, Engineering and Math) or associated degree & 5 years experience in development of automated test systems.
Demonstrated experience designing and developing automated test systems into manufacturing environment.
Proven expertise in NI LabVIEW and NI TestStand for test software development and debugging.
Experience in C/C for test firmware development and debugging.
Experience in Python and PyQt for test software development and debugging.
Good understanding and knowledge of principles, theories, and concepts relevant to software engineering
Proficient in usage of DMM, power supply, oscilloscope, and other lab equipment.
Familiarity with medical device regulations and governance documents (ISO13485, CFR820, IEC 60601-X).
